Meet the Innovative Functions in Windows 11
Windows 11 is Microsoft’s newly released major OS, delivering a slick and organized user layout. It installs a middle-based Start Menu with a minimalist taskbar layout, and curved edges to give a seamless and sleek touch. Faster processing leads to a smoother user experience.
